Output a763c5af067d162c6b9179aebd05030d682fb14ba547f955adccb1e4a9429964:1

value
12585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f625c82433b978dd93b3ca128dcde8ac587cc771 OP_EQUAL
address
3Q8XQrpFMaFiFvZm67oKLy8rAdaRzzmDde
transaction
a763c5af067d162c6b9179aebd05030d682fb14ba547f955adccb1e4a9429964
confirmations
166157
spent
true